Company profile
Deep tech University of Glasgow spin-out, Vector Photonics is a specialist semiconductor laser company developing patented Photonic Crystal Surface Emitting Laser (PCSEL) technology. PCSELs combine high optical power, excellent beam quality, broad wavelength flexibility and low-cost, scalable manufacturing in a surface-emitting architecture, offering significant advantages over conventional edge-emitting lasers. As a fabless company, Vector Photonics leverages established commercial semiconductor foundries to enable rapid scaling and cost-effective production. The technology has been demonstrated in real-world applications, including a free-space optical communications link across the River Clyde, highlighting its potential for next-generation communications. PCSELs are well positioned for emerging AI and hyperscale data centre applications, where efficient, high-performance optical interconnects are increasingly critical. Beyond communications, the technology offers opportunities in LiDAR, sensing and industrial processing.
